Robert Dempsey is an associate in Bass, Berry & Sims' Corporate and Securities Practice Area. His practice involves the representation of public and private companies in a variety of capacities, including mergers and acquisitions, private placements of securities and corporate governance.
A native of Memphis, Robert graduated cum laude from Duke University with a B.A. degree in history in 1998. While at Duke, Robert was elected to serve in the Student Government. After graduating, he attended the business bridge program at the Tuck School of Business at Dartmouth College.
In 2006, Robert received his law degree from Vanderbilt University Law School, with a concentration in law and business. While in law school, he received the Legal Writing Scholastic Excellence award, the Paul H. Sanders scholarship and was named to the Dean's List. Robert joined Bass, Berry & Sims as an associate in September of 2006.
Prior to law school, Robert worked in corporate finance for a Fortune 500 company in Memphis.
